简要总结

Vestibular dysfunction has traditionally been linked to various conditions that affect older adults. Recent studies have shown that children and adolescents suffer from vestibular impairments, yet the numbers are still low due to some factors, including the non-typical presentations. Vestibular migraine has been found to be the most common condition of vestibular dysfunction among children and adolescents. Nonetheless, most children remain undiagnosed due to lack awareness and vague clinical presentations. Parallel to that, there has been no consensus regarding the management algorithm. Most children are managed with pharmacological management extrapolated from the adult algorithm. Many clinicians fail to understand that pharmacological treatments are not sustainable long-term and should focus on lifestyle modifications such as sleep and dietary habits and other non-pharmacological treatments such as deep breathing exercises and vestibular rehabilitation therapy. This study aims to investigate the effect of non-pharmacological treatment in managing children and adolescents with VM. The investigators will use a standardised questionnaire before and after interventions to investigate the effect of lifestyle modifications, simple vestibular rehabilitation exercises and deep breathing techniques in children and adolescents with VM. Lifestyle modifications and vestibular rehabilitation exercise is a more sustainable way of managing children and adolescents with VM, avoiding the side effects of medication, and is more cost-effective. If the non-pharmacological treatment shows promising results, the investigators will continue with multicentre randomised-controlled studies.

详细描述

The prevalence of vestibular dysfunction is approximately 30.4% among children and adolescents. Yet, the exact prevalence in children remains a quandary owing to several factors: difficulties describing symptoms and cannot differentiate between true vertigo, unsteadiness, imbalance and light-headedness; secondly, the short-lived nature of some peripheral vestibular conditions results in early and rapid compensation; thirdly, nuanced clinical manifestations of vestibular as well as balance impairment accounts for it being overlooked finally, lack of specialists to manage children with vestibular impairment.

Vestibular dysfunction or impairment results in disturbance in the body's balance system. Nonetheless, the most common symptoms include vertigo, nausea, vomiting, intolerance to head motion, nystagmus, unsteady gait, and postural instability. Although clinical presentation may be mild, vestibular dysfunction may impact the quality of life and day-to-day activity, especially school activities such as reading and learning, which are vital for these age groups.

Vestibular loss affects cognitive and emotional disturbance related to reflexive deficits, which are related to the role of ascending vestibular pathway to the limbic system and the neocortex's role in the sense of spatial orientation. Vestibular and balance impairment amongst adolescents and young adults will, in the long term, affect social, emotional, psychological and quality of life as vestibular and balance function is imperative in day-to-day life and activity.

Vestibular migraine (VM) is found to be the most common cause of dizziness among children and adolescents. The exact prevalence of VM remains unknown as VM is still underdiagnosed due to a lack of awareness amongst parents and attending physicians. It is worth noting that the diagnosis of VM in children and adolescents has traditionally been based on the description of clinical symptoms by the patient or parents/caretaker. The lack of definitive biomarkers and gold-standard diagnostic tools contributes to the delay in diagnosis. The typical battery of investigations, including otological, neurological, ophthalmological, and imaging performed, are oftentimes carried out to rule out other pathological disorders.

Vestibular migraine in children is diagnosed based on diagnostic criteria which recently has been put forth by the Committee for the Classification of Vestibular Disorders of the Bar any Society (ICVD) and the Migraine Classification subgroup of the International Headache Society, which describes the three spectrums of VM: Vestibular Migraine of Childhood, probable Vestibular Migraine of Childhood and Recurrent Vertigo of Childhood specific for children under 18 years of age.
